What You Need To Know About Cosmetic Dentistry

What to expect


When talking to the dentist about your smile, tell them precisely what you want to change. You can bring pictures of the way your mouth used to look or how you want it to look. A comprehensive oral exam is going to be needed to address any serious issues. The dentist and their patient should review a plan, which would be customized to fit your goals, your available time and your budget. They will discuss treatment options and develop a plan of action.


Treatment Options


There are a variety of procedures available that can be tailored and combined to tackle your needs. These procedures include veneers, crowns, bridges, implants, whitening and orthodontics.


Fixing Tooth Damage


Dental veneers can help with worn tooth enamel, uneven tooth alignment, abnormal spacing or chips and cracks in your teeth. They are placed over the front of the tooth to recreate the look of natural teeth. Veneers are often made from composite resin (a tooth-colouring filling material) or porcelain. Dental crowns, which are tooth-shaped caps that are placed over your tooth to restore the tooth’s shape, size and strength as well as improve appearance.


Replacing Missing Teeth


Dental bridges are an option for replacing missing teeth. They are supported by the natural teeth around them or by implants to bridge gaps between missing teeth. Dental implants are artificial tooth roots that provide a permanent base for fixed, replacement teeth.


Getting a Brighter and Whiter Smile


Teeth whitening is a quick and non-invasive way to improve your smile. There are three options for teeth whitening: in-office whitening, professionally dispensed take-home whitening kits or over-the-counter teeth whitening. In-office whitening involves applying a protective gel to your gums and applying bleach to the teeth.


Straightening Your Smile


Traditional braces and Invisalign (invisible braces) are used to combat poor alignment and adjust the teeth’s position.
